In the tender for "Construction of Jõgeva town's separate sewage and rainwater pipelines", bids are evaluated solely on cost, with the lowest price receiving the maximum score.
Bidders must prove they have no grounds for exclusion and that their responsible specialist possesses the required professional qualification for managing water and sewage works.
